Posts: 2323 Location: Stevens Point, WI | Day One was a record day for the 2008 Rhinelander Toyota Hodag Muskie Challenge. 38 fish were registered, and six teams doubled! Leaders Shane Spencer and Mike Marquardt were done by 1pm with two fish measuring 42.25 and 41.50 coming off Boom Lake. Sitting in very close second with two fish are Josh Wood and Jason Baars with 119 points that included day 1 big fish 45.50 and a 37.25 that came from Crescent Lake. Locals Jeff Piazza and Bill Donner are holding down third place with two fish that measured 44.75 and 36.00. Dan Meyer and Todd Forcier are in fourth and were the first team to double and be done by 9:30am with a 44.50 and a 35.50. Fifth is being held by Nathan Bell and Brett Chariton with a 43.50 and a 35.75 from fourth lake of the Moen Chain. Anglers interviewed by MuskieFIRST all had some kind of action whether it be a missed fish or follows, the bite seemed to be strong throughout the day but the moon set at 1:30 seemed to be a key bite for the Field. A record day for overall total of fish with 16 of 38 fish over 40 inches. Stay tuned for final day morning interviews, images and a final day wrap up.
